Downing Renewables & Infrastructure (LON:DORE – Get Free Report) shares traded up 2.4% during mid-day trading on Monday . The stock traded as high as GBX 84.99 ($1.07) and last traded at GBX 84.60 ($1.07). 74,665 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 69% from the average session volume of 244,525 shares. The stock had previously closed at GBX 82.60 ($1.04).
Downing Renewables & Infrastructure Stock Up 2.4 %
The firm’s 50-day moving average price is GBX 83.05 and its 200 day moving average price is GBX 81.57. The firm has a market cap of £143.14 million and a P/E ratio of 21.75.
Downing Renewables & Infrastructure Company Profile
Downing Renewables & Infrastructure Trust PLC (DORE) is a renewable energy and infrastructure trust designed to deliver stable and sustainable returns through diversification across technology, geography and project stage. It has a diversified portfolio of renewable energy generating assets and other infrastructure assets across the UK, Ireland and Northern Europe.
